Berry Bliss & Slice of Summer Fruit Cards with Mendi

Hello and welcome! This is Mendi here today, popping in to share some fruit-themed cards for Summer using our fabulous Berry Bliss Stamps and Slice of Summer Stamps.

Sunny Studio Citrus, Strawberry, Watermelon, & Cherries Fruit Cards using Slice of Summer & Berry Bliss Clear Layering Stamps

First, I have a card using the layered citrus slice from our Slice of Summer Stamps, which I stamped to look like lemon, lime, grapefruit, and orange slices. I then die-cut a stitched circle using our Stitched Circle Small Dies, where I lightly drew 12 spokes on the back with my pencil and clear ruler like I was slicing a pizza or adding clock tick marks to give me a way to evenly space my fruit slices. Then, on the back of each slice, I drew a pencil through the center at the halfway mark to give me another point to line up each slice. I then arranged each slice, having them overlap the outside edge of my white cardstock circle by 1/2". I used liquid adhesive for this task to have a little wiggle room to adjust them before they dried as I quickly worked around the circle. As I was starting this project, I was nervous about my ability to make it look symmetrical. However, the easy measurement tricks I described worked, and I assembled this summer "wreath" rather quickly. 

I then used our Scalloped Square 1 Large Dies to die-cut the striped paper to match the fruit from our Summer Splash Paper pack. After it was die-cut, I carefully used my paper trimmer to trim off the four scalloped edges and leave a small border around the stitching. This gave me the perfect stitched square to layer over the same scalloped square cut from white cardstock for my card base. I cut a second white scalloped square to score along the top and to adhere to the backside of my card front to form my notecard. Lastly, I stamped the greeting from the Slice of Summer Stamps, substituting the word "slice" from our Hayley 
Uppercase Alphabet Dies and Hayley Lowercase Alphabet Dies.

Sunny Studio Citrus Slice of Happiness Wreath Card using Slice of Summer Clear Layering Craft Stamps & Scalloped Square Dies

My second card pairs the watermelon from the Slice of Summer Stamps with the strawberries, raspberries, and cherries from our Berry Bliss Stamps. I arranged them in and around our Layered Basket Stamps, wrapping twine around the basket and popping it up with foam tape to help it lie flat with the thickness of the twine. I stamped and heat-embossed the greeting "You're so sweet" from our Punny Fruit Greetings Stamps onto a small tag cut with our Sweet Treats Gift Bag Die, which I topped with a twine bow. I also stamped a subtle pink diagonal grid pattern using our Background Basics 2 Stamps with VersaFine Clair Baby Pink Ink to add some interest to my background.

Baby Elephant Card with Tina

Hello crafters, it’s Tina and today I am making a mini slimline card with the sweet Baby Elephants stamps and die set! I always try to have cards for several occasions in my stash and this set is just perfect for a new baby.

Sunny Studio Stamps: Baby Elephant Card by Tina Henkens (featuring Hello Word Die, Hayley Alphabet Die, Rounded Rectangle Mat Dies)

To start, I cut a white rectangle background panel to the size of a mini slimline using a die from my stash. As an extra layer I also created a white panel with one of the Rounded Rectangle MatsNow it was time to choose one of the adorable elephants, stamp the image on the mat and enjoy some Copic coloring.

Next, I glued both pieces together with liquid glue and pulled a sky stencil for ink blending with Seedless Preserves and Milled Lavender Distress Oxide. I used a small blending brush and was able to avoid stenciling over the image. Of course, you can always cut a mask, but these tiny brushes work very well. I added some purple dots with a Copic marker for extra depth.

Sunny Studio Stamps: Baby Elephant Card by Tina Henkens (featuring Hello Word Die, Hayley Alphabet Die, Rounded Rectangle Mat Dies)

Then it was time to select the letters to spell the word ‘baby’ from a purple paper (Hayley Lowercase Alphabet). I also used the Hello word die cut (Dots & Stripes Pastel). By placing the rounded mat near the bottom of the mini slimline panel, I kept room to add both words above the image.

Next, I created a white card base with another die from my stash and added the cloudy panels with foam tape. As a final embellishment, I cut several sizes of stars (Comic Strip Speech Bubbles), colored them with the same yellow copics as the moon and spread them across the card. This makes the design even more dreamy and sweet.

Wild Cherry Die Focused Card with Leanne

Hi there! Leanne here sharing a cherryful card today. I simply could not resist adding the fun play on words to my card featuring how I've used the Wild Cherry dies

Sunny Studio Stamps: Wild Cherry Die Focused Card by Leanne West (featuring Punny Fruit Greetings, Hayley Alphabet Dies, Frilly Frame Dies)

This A2 card design is very easy to make. I started by creating a soft minty background with scalloped edge detail. To get this detail, I used the Frilly Frame Hexagon die to create a mask that covers the edges of the card front and then I applied the ink in the negative space. The minty aqua color is Catherine Pooler Hot Tub. 

I die cut 7 cherries, stems, and leaves from white card stock. I used small blending brushes and the following Catherine Pooler inks to color: Peppermint Scrub for the cherries, Matcha + Spruce for the leaves, Over Coffee for the stems. 

Sunny Studio Stamps: Wild Cherry Die Focused Card by Leanne West (featuring Punny Fruit Greetings, Hayley Alphabet Dies, Frilly Frame Dies)

I arranged the cherries along the bottom half of the card front so I'd have room above them to add a custom greeting. The stamped part of the sentiment are words included in the Punny Fruit Greetings stamp set. I used the Hayley Lower Case Alphabet dies to cut out letters that spell "cherryful". I cut the letters from white card stock and colored with a combo of Peppermint Scrub and Merlot CP inks. To finish this design I added a few green sequins scattered around the greeting area.

Juicy Watermelon Card with Cathy

Hey friends! Cathy here today sharing a clean and simple friendship card today featuring the Juicy Watermelon Dies.

Sunny Studio Stamps: Juicy Watermelon Card by Cathy Chapdelaine (featuring Frilly Frame Dies, Punny Fruit Greetings, Hayley Alphabet Dies)

This was so fun to make and works up quickly. I started by cutting a piece of white cardstock 5” x 6” and lightly inked across the center of the cardstock with Spun Sugar Distress ink. I cut a strip of Gingham Pastels Paper 1 1/4" x 6” and adhered it to the bottom of the cardstock. I then die-cut the cardstock using the frame portion of the Frilly Frames Quatrefoil Dies and adhered it to an A2 card front.

Next, I die-cut 5 watermelon slices using the Juicy Watermelon Dies and 2 leaves/small flowers using the Strawberry Patch Dies from white cardstock. I colored the watermelon slices and flowers with Copics and inked the leaves with Mowed Lawn/Rustic Wilderness Distress inks. For extra cuteness, I die-cut my center slice with the smiley face die from the Fresh Lemon Dies and added a stamped/Copic colored pair of shades using a stamp from the Beach Buddies Stamps. I just love how they fit the smiley face perfectly! I adhered the die-cuts across the card and then decided to die-cut 2 larger flowers using the “free with purchase” mini die currently available. I also colored these flowers with Copics.

Sunny Studio Stamps: Juicy Watermelon Card by Cathy Chapdelaine (featuring Frilly Frame Dies, Punny Fruit Greetings, Hayley Alphabet Dies)

To finish, I heat embossed a sentiment from the Punny Fruit Greetings Stamps with white embossing powder on a strip of black cardstock and die-cut the “melon” sentiment from black cardstock using the Hayley Lowercase Alphabet Dies.

Big Bunny Card with Cathy

Hey friends! Cathy here today with a fun birthday card featuring the Big Bunny Stamps. I just love how this adorable bunny can be used for so many occasions!

Sunny Studio Stamps: Big Bunny Birthday Card by Cathy Chapdelaine (featuring Bright Balloons Dies, Crepe Paper Streamer Dies, Ribbon & Lace Border Dies, Hayley Alphabet Dies)

This is an A2 card and I started with a festive multi-colored background. I cut a piece of white cardstock 4" x 5 1/2" and inked it with Tumbled Glass, Spun Sugar, Twisted Citron and Squeezed Lemonade Distress inks. For stitched detailing, I die-cut the 5 1/2" edges of the panel using a Ribbon & Lace Borders Die.

Next, I die-cut balloons and streamers from white cardstock using the Bright Balloons Dies and Crepe Paper Streamers Dies. I inked them with the same Distress inks as the panel. I adhered the streamers first and trimmed the excess from the edges. For the balloon strings, I tied gray embroidery floss to each and then adhered the balloons.

I stamped the bunny and bow from the Big Bunny Stamps and the cupcake from the Holiday Hugs Stamps on Neenah Classic Crest 80lb solar white cardstock, colored them with Copics and die-cut them using the coordinating dies. I adhered the bunny to the bottom of the panel and added a strip of Spring Fever Paper along the bottom that I die-cut using a Ribbon & Lace Borders Die and cut to 4" long.

Sunny Studio Stamps: Big Bunny Birthday Card by Cathy Chapdelaine (featuring Bright Balloons Dies, Crepe Paper Streamer Dies, Ribbon & Lace Border Dies, Hayley Alphabet Dies)

I cut 2 strips of black cardstock 5 1/2" long and adhered one under each side of the background panel so just a sliver of black is visible. I then adhered the panel to a white card front.

To finish, I die-cut a punny sentiment from gray and black cardstock using the Hayley Lowercase Alphabet Dies and an exclamation point from the Hayley Uppercase Alphabet Dies. I slightly overlapped the colors to make the gray stand out a bit more. I stamped the "IT'S YOUR BIRTHDAY!" sentiment from the Puddle Jumpers Stamps on a strip of gray cardstock.
